a. What is the monthly return on this investment vehicle?
The formula for the value of a Perpetuity is;
Value = Payment/ rate
Rate = Payment/ Value
Rate = 1,450/114,000
= 0.0127
= 1.27%
b. What is the APR?
APR is the annual rate. The above figure is the monthly rate.
APR = Monthly rate * 12
= 1.27 * 12
= 15.24%
c. What is the effective annual return?
Effective annual return = [1 + (APR/n)]^n – 1
n is the number of compounding periods which is 12 here for monthly compounding.
= [1 + (15.24%/12)]^12– 1
= 16.35%
